logo

Output 58d355249283a4762dd40e7acd97ae8c0fc352c79af3793776fb7e7953c51106:0

value
1626029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24de6468f2520b8ec6bb6bfa96d3a6c95d974174 OP_EQUALVERIFY OP_CHECKSIG
address
14MwjzLuUrHNd1B7Lcf8mv3JkWTb1BzH6d
transaction
58d355249283a4762dd40e7acd97ae8c0fc352c79af3793776fb7e7953c51106